Japan’s JPX Reports Falling MoM Volumes in July
The Japan Exchange Group (JPX) has released its trading volumes for July 2018. The exchange, which operates theTokyo Stock Exchange (TSE) and Osaka Exchange (OSE), saw month-on-month declines in its derivatives and cash equity markets, but they were still up on a yearly comparison.
In July this year, the average trading value for domestic common stocks on the TSE was $24.1 billion (¥2.7011 trillion). For domestic common stocks, the total trading value for all exchanges was $452.6 billion (¥56.7 trillion) or 32 billion shares. This was a decline of 4.6 percent month-on-month and 16.9 percent year-on-year.
